In Summary, verify that Spectrum/Charter ISP has opened UDP ports 123, 500 and 4500 …AT&T Microcell and T-Mobile CellSpot are both are based on femtocell technology. Whereas cell phone signal boosters are based on a different Bi-Directional Amplifier (BDA) technology so they work differently. However, all of these are used to improve cellular coverage. You need to plug in the GPS antenna and give it about 24 hours to locate itself. Per FCC regulations, as a fixed-location transmitter, its exact location must be registered. A microcell -- including T-Mobile's "4G LTE CellSpot" -- uses your home Internet connection to transfer data. There's no way to prevent people from connecting to your microcell. Really, it's not even your microcell, you should think of it as the cellular service provider's tower. Anyone nearby using a phone or other device on that cellular ...Check Current Status.
